About Me
Robert Stewart, M.D., is a radiation oncologist specializing in the treatment of Head and Neck, Genitourinary and Ocular Malignancies. He uses many advanced techniques such Intensity Modulated Radiation Therapy (IMRT), Image Guided Radiation Therapy (IGRT), Stereotactic Body Radiation Therapy (SBRT), and brachytherapy to maximize local control and cure of the cancer while minimizing radiation side effects to healthy tissue.
Dr. Stewart graduated from Dalhousie University with a medical degree. He completed his Residency in Radiation Oncology at the Juravinski Cancer Center through McMaster University. Dr. Stewart then went on to complete a Fellowship in Brachytherapy through the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ai Beth Israel Hospital.
Dr. Stewart’s primary research focus is attempting to improve clinical outcomes while limiting side effects in management of prostate cancer. In addition, Dr. Stewart has conducted research in the areas of adaptive treatment for Head and Neck Cancer and Intraoperative Radiotherapy. His work has resulted in multiple presentations at international meetings.
